What is IMTS?

The International Manufacturing Technology Show is one of the largest industrial trade shows in the world. Held biennially at McCormick Place in Chicago, it gathers creators, innovators, and manufacturers to showcase the most cutting-edge technologies shaping the future of production.

At IMTS, students had the chance to explore everything from additive manufacturing and robotics to smart factory systems and AI-driven analytics tools. The show offers a comprehensive look into the modern manufacturing landscape and what lies ahead.

Real-World Exposure for Future Engineers

Exposure to real-world technologies is a key pillar of Purdue Polytechnic’s educational approach. By attending IMTS, Polytechnic students got a valuable glimpse into how theoretical concepts taught in the classroom are applied in practice.

Students explored hundreds of booths and demonstrations presented by global manufacturers who are redefining what’s possible in manufacturing through:

  • Automation and robotics – including collaborative robots (cobots) and AI integrations
  • Smart manufacturing – digital twins, cloud computing, and machine learning applications
  • Advanced materials – developments in composites, lightweight alloys, and sustainability-focused materials
  • Precision machining – CNC technologies and ultra-fine-tolerance instruments

For many students, this interaction with real-world devices and professionals deepened their understanding of how modern engineers and technicians contribute to innovation cycles.
